Five Killed in Lahore Gas Explosion

A devastating gas cylinder explosion in a shop on Lahore’s Ravi Road late Tuesday night caused a three-story building to collapse, claiming five lives and leaving six others injured.

The blast ignited a fire that rapidly engulfed the structure, according to officials from the Edhi Foundation. The explosion’s intensity brought down all three floors of the building.

Rescue operations were launched swiftly, with emergency crews pulling survivors from the wreckage and transporting the injured to a nearby hospital. Bodies of the deceased have been recovered and shifted to the morgue.

Efforts are ongoing to clear debris and ensure no one remains trapped beneath the rubble.

Police have cordoned off the site and begun a formal investigation to determine the circumstances leading up to the explosion.
